Zipcar has the best local coverage. They have a car and van in Perry Vale car park plus other vehicles dotted about. You're not likely to be more than 5 minutes from one of their cars.
I joined last year because I needed a car on Boxing Day. I've only used it once since. It is so rare that I need to drive in London.

I'm a ZipCar member, and very happy with the service. The pricing is aimed at short journeys in London, so exactly what's needed for helping someone move to a new flat, which was the last time I used it.
Otherwise I use it for trips out of London, when the public transport to wherever I'm going is not good, when the flexibility and time saving makes it worth paying more than the train, or when three or more are travelling together, so the shared costs beats the train.
